亚洲国产日韩欧美一区二区三区,精品亚洲国产成人av在线,国产99视频精品免视看7,99国产精品久久久久久久成人热,欧美日韩亚洲国产综合乱

目錄
1。安裝綁定
2。配置主綁定文件( named.conf.options
3。設(shè)置一個向前區(qū)域(域到IP)
一個。添加named.conf.local named.conf區(qū)域。
b。創(chuàng)建區(qū)域文件
4。(可選)設(shè)置一個反向區(qū)域(IP到域)
一個。添加反向區(qū)域
b。創(chuàng)建反向區(qū)域文件
5。測試配置和重新啟動綁定
6。測試DNS服務(wù)器
最后筆記
首頁 系統(tǒng)教程 操作系統(tǒng) 如何使用綁定在Linux上設(shè)置DNS服務(wù)器

如何使用綁定在Linux上設(shè)置DNS服務(wù)器

Aug 03, 2025 pm 12:11 PM

使用軟件包管理器安裝綁定(ubuntu/debian的APT,DNF用于Centos/Rhel)。 2。在nuper.conf.options或named.conf中配置全局選項,以允許查詢,設(shè)置轉(zhuǎn)發(fā)器(例如8.8.8.8),啟用遞歸并在所有接口上收聽。 3。通過在名為conf.local(ubuntu)或name.conf(centos)中添加一個區(qū)域條目來設(shè)置一個正區(qū)域,并使用SOA,NS和一個soa,ns和一個記錄映射主機(jī)名映射到IPS的區(qū)域文件(例如,db.example.local)。 4??蛇x,通過定義配置中的反向區(qū)域并創(chuàng)建相應(yīng)的反向區(qū)域文件(例如DB.192.168.1)來配置PTR記錄的反向區(qū)域。 5。帶有命名-CheckConf的測試配置語法,并帶有名為-Checkzone的區(qū)域文件,然后重新啟動Bind Service(在CentOS上命名的Ubuntu上的Bind9),并在啟動下啟用它。 6.使用DIG或NSLOOKUP進(jìn)行轉(zhuǎn)發(fā)和反向查找的測試DNS分辨率,并更新客戶端DNS設(shè)置以指向新服務(wù)器;確保區(qū)域串行在更改上增加,并使用RNDC Reload應(yīng)用更新而無需完全重新啟動,同時將服務(wù)器固定在開放分辨率和監(jiān)視日志上,并適當(dāng)?shù)乇O(jiān)視日志。

如何使用綁定在Linux上設(shè)置DNS服務(wù)器

使用BIND(Berkeley Internet名稱域)在Linux上設(shè)置DNS服務(wù)器是管理內(nèi)部網(wǎng)絡(luò)分辨率或托管域名的常見任務(wù)。綁定是Unix樣系統(tǒng)上使用的最廣泛使用的DNS軟件。這是在典型的Linux發(fā)行版(如Ubuntu或CentOS)上逐步設(shè)置它的方法。

如何使用綁定在Linux上設(shè)置DNS服務(wù)器

1。安裝綁定

首先,使用發(fā)行版的軟件包管理器安裝綁定軟件包。

在Ubuntu/Debian上:

如何使用綁定在Linux上設(shè)置DNS服務(wù)器
 sudo apt更新
sudo apt安裝bind9 bind9utils bind9-doc

在Centos/Rhel/Rocky Linux上:

 sudo dnf安裝bind -util -y

安裝后,主要配置文件通常位于/etc/bind/ (debian/ubuntu)或/etc/named.conf (基于RHEL)中。

如何使用綁定在Linux上設(shè)置DNS服務(wù)器

2。配置主綁定文件( named.conf.options

編輯全局選項文件,以定義DNS服務(wù)器的行為。

在Ubuntu上:

 sudo nano /etc/bind/named.conf.options

在Centos上:

 sudo nano /etc /named.conf

添加或修改options塊以允許查詢和設(shè)置逆轉(zhuǎn)器(例如Google的DNS):

選項 {
    目錄“/var/cache/bind”;

    //允許您本地網(wǎng)絡(luò)的查詢
    允許Query {localhost; 192.168.1.0/24; };

    //將DNS查詢轉(zhuǎn)發(fā)到外部服務(wù)器
    轉(zhuǎn)發(fā)器{
        8.8.8.8;
        8.8.4.4;
    };

    //啟用遞歸
    遞歸是的;

    //禁用DNSSEC以進(jìn)行簡單(可選)
    DNSSEC-validation no;

    //在所有接口上收聽
    在v6 {any-ny; };
    聽聽{Any; };
};

用實際的網(wǎng)絡(luò)子網(wǎng)替換192.168.1.0/24


3。設(shè)置一個向前區(qū)域(域到IP)

這允許您的DNS服務(wù)器將域名(例如, example.local )解析為內(nèi)部IP。

一個。添加named.conf.local named.conf區(qū)域。

在Ubuntu上:

 sudo nano /etc/bind/named.conf.local

添加:

區(qū)域“ example.local” {
    類型主;
    文件“ /etc/bind/db.example.local”;
};

在CentOS上:在適當(dāng)?shù)牟糠种刑砑?code>/etc/named.conf中的相同塊。

b。創(chuàng)建區(qū)域文件

復(fù)制默認(rèn)區(qū)域模板:

 sudo cp /etc/bind/db.local/etc/bind/db.example.local

編輯新文件:

 sudo nano /etc/bind/db.example.local

這樣更新它:

 $ TTL 604800
@ in Soa ns1.example.local。 admin.example.Local。 ((
                              3;系列
                         604800;刷新
                          86400;重試
                        2419200;到期
                         604800);負(fù)緩存TTL
;
@ in NS NS1.Example.local。
@在192.168.1.10中
NS1在192.168.1.10
www在192.168.1.20
郵寄192.168.1.30
  • 根據(jù)需要更換IP。
  • @表示域本身。
  • 電子郵件admin.example.local.對應(yīng)于admin@example.local (請注意落后點(diǎn))。

4。(可選)設(shè)置一個反向區(qū)域(IP到域)

這允許反向DNS查找(PTR記錄)。

一個。添加反向區(qū)域

named.conf.local (ubuntu)或named.conf (Centos)中:

區(qū)域“ 1.168.192.in-addr.arpa” {
    類型主;
    文件“ /etc/bind/db.192.168.1”;
};

b。創(chuàng)建反向區(qū)域文件

sudo cp /etc/bind/db.127 /etc/bind/db.192.168.1
sudo nano /etc/bind/db.192.168.1

編輯:

 $ TTL 604800
@ in Soa ns1.example.local。 admin.example.Local。 ((
                              2;系列
                         604800;刷新
                          86400;重試
                        2419200;到期
                         604800);負(fù)緩存TTL
;
@ in NS NS1.Example.local。
10在ptr ns1.example.Local中。
20在ptr www.example.local中。
30在ptr mail.example.local中。

此地圖IPS類似192.168.1.10ns1.example.local 。


5。測試配置和重新啟動綁定

檢查語法錯誤:

 sudo命名為checkconf

檢查區(qū)域文件:

 sudo naty-checkzone示例.local /etc/bind/db.example.local
sudo命名-Checkzone 1.168.192.in-addr.arpa /etc/bind/db.192.168.1

如果一切都很好,重新啟動綁定:

Ubuntu:

 sudo systemctl restart bind9

Centos:

 sudo systemctl重新啟動命名

啟用啟動:

 sudo systemctl啟用bind9?;蛎?/pre>

6。測試DNS服務(wù)器

使用dignslookup驗證:

 dig @localhost示例
dig @localhost www.example.local
DIG -X 192.168.1.20

您應(yīng)該看到正確的A或PTR記錄。

另外,更新您的客戶端機(jī)器以將該服務(wù)器用作其DNS(例如,將DNS設(shè)置為192.168.1.10在網(wǎng)絡(luò)設(shè)置中)。


最后筆記

  • 更改區(qū)域文件時,請保持序列號更新(增加它們)。
  • 使用rndc reload到重新加載區(qū)域而不重新啟動:
     sudo rndc重新加載示例。
  • 保護(hù)您的DNS服務(wù)器:避免打開解析器,使用ACL,并在/var/log/syslog/var/log/messages中監(jiān)視日志。
  • 基本上,就是這樣 - 您現(xiàn)在使用Linux上的Bind擁有一個工作權(quán)威和遞歸DNS服務(wù)器。這不是復(fù)雜的,而是對語法和權(quán)限的關(guān)注很重要。

    以上是如何使用綁定在Linux上設(shè)置DNS服務(wù)器的詳細(xì)內(nèi)容。更多信息請關(guān)注PHP中文網(wǎng)其他相關(guān)文章!

本站聲明
本文內(nèi)容由網(wǎng)友自發(fā)貢獻(xiàn),版權(quán)歸原作者所有,本站不承擔(dān)相應(yīng)法律責(zé)任。如您發(fā)現(xiàn)有涉嫌抄襲侵權(quán)的內(nèi)容,請聯(lián)系admin@php.cn

熱AI工具

Undress AI Tool

Undress AI Tool

免費(fèi)脫衣服圖片

Undresser.AI Undress

Undresser.AI Undress

人工智能驅(qū)動的應(yīng)用程序,用于創(chuàng)建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用于從照片中去除衣服的在線人工智能工具。

Clothoff.io

Clothoff.io

AI脫衣機(jī)

Video Face Swap

Video Face Swap

使用我們完全免費(fèi)的人工智能換臉工具輕松在任何視頻中換臉!

熱工具

記事本++7.3.1

記事本++7.3.1

好用且免費(fèi)的代碼編輯器

SublimeText3漢化版

SublimeText3漢化版

中文版,非常好用

禪工作室 13.0.1

禪工作室 13.0.1

功能強(qiáng)大的PHP集成開發(fā)環(huán)境

Dreamweaver CS6

Dreamweaver CS6

視覺化網(wǎng)頁開發(fā)工具

SublimeText3 Mac版

SublimeText3 Mac版

神級代碼編輯軟件(SublimeText3)

熱門話題

Laravel 教程
1597
29
PHP教程
1488
72
在RHEL,Rocky和Almalinux中安裝LXC(Linux容器) 在RHEL,Rocky和Almalinux中安裝LXC(Linux容器) Jul 05, 2025 am 09:25 AM

LXD被描述為下一代容器和虛擬機(jī)管理器,它為在容器內(nèi)部或虛擬機(jī)中運(yùn)行的Linux系統(tǒng)提供了沉浸式的。 它為有支持的Linux分布數(shù)量提供圖像

如何在Linux機(jī)器上解決DNS問題? 如何在Linux機(jī)器上解決DNS問題? Jul 07, 2025 am 12:35 AM

遇到DNS問題時首先要檢查/etc/resolv.conf文件,查看是否配置了正確的nameserver;其次可手動添加如8.8.8.8等公共DNS進(jìn)行測試;接著使用nslookup和dig命令驗證DNS解析是否正常,若未安裝這些工具可先安裝dnsutils或bind-utils包;再檢查systemd-resolved服務(wù)狀態(tài)及其配置文件/etc/systemd/resolved.conf,并根據(jù)需要設(shè)置DNS和FallbackDNS后重啟服務(wù);最后排查網(wǎng)絡(luò)接口狀態(tài)與防火墻規(guī)則,確認(rèn)53端口未

您將如何調(diào)試速度慢或使用高內(nèi)存使用量的服務(wù)器? 您將如何調(diào)試速度慢或使用高內(nèi)存使用量的服務(wù)器? Jul 06, 2025 am 12:02 AM

發(fā)現(xiàn)服務(wù)器運(yùn)行緩慢或內(nèi)存占用過高時,應(yīng)先排查原因再操作。首先要查看系統(tǒng)資源使用情況,用top、htop、free-h、iostat、ss-antp等命令檢查CPU、內(nèi)存、磁盤I/O和網(wǎng)絡(luò)連接;其次分析具體進(jìn)程問題,通過ps、jstack、strace等工具追蹤高占用進(jìn)程的行為;接著檢查日志和監(jiān)控數(shù)據(jù),查看OOM記錄、異常請求、慢查詢等線索;最后根據(jù)常見原因如內(nèi)存泄漏、連接池耗盡、緩存失效風(fēng)暴、定時任務(wù)沖突進(jìn)行針對性處理,優(yōu)化代碼邏輯,設(shè)置超時重試機(jī)制,加限流熔斷,并定期壓測評估資源。

在Ubuntu中安裝用于遠(yuǎn)程Linux/Windows訪問的鱷梨調(diào)味醬 在Ubuntu中安裝用于遠(yuǎn)程Linux/Windows訪問的鱷梨調(diào)味醬 Jul 08, 2025 am 09:58 AM

作為系統(tǒng)管理員,您可能會發(fā)現(xiàn)自己(今天或?qū)恚┰赪indows和Linux并存的環(huán)境中工作。 有些大公司更喜歡(或必須)在Windows Box上運(yùn)行其一些生產(chǎn)服務(wù)已不是什么秘密

如何使用Brasero在Linux中燃燒CD/DVD 如何使用Brasero在Linux中燃燒CD/DVD Jul 05, 2025 am 09:26 AM

坦率地說,我不記得上一次使用CD/DVD驅(qū)動器的PC。這要?dú)w功于不斷發(fā)展的科技行業(yè),該行業(yè)已被USB驅(qū)動器和其他較小且緊湊的存儲媒體所取代,這些磁盤可提供更多存儲

如何在Linux中找到我的私人和公共IP地址? 如何在Linux中找到我的私人和公共IP地址? Jul 09, 2025 am 12:37 AM

在Linux系統(tǒng)中,1.使用ipa或hostname-I命令可查看私有IP;2.使用curlifconfig.me或curlipinfo.io/ip可獲取公網(wǎng)IP;3.桌面版可通過系統(tǒng)設(shè)置查看私有IP,瀏覽器訪問特定網(wǎng)站查看公網(wǎng)IP;4.可將常用命令設(shè)為別名以便快速調(diào)用。這些方法簡單實用,適合不同場景下的IP查看需求。

如何在Rocky Linux 8上安裝Nodejs 14/16&npm 如何在Rocky Linux 8上安裝Nodejs 14/16&npm Jul 13, 2025 am 09:09 AM

Node.js建立在Chrome的V8引擎上,是一種開源的,由事件驅(qū)動的JavaScript運(yùn)行時環(huán)境,用于構(gòu)建可擴(kuò)展應(yīng)用程序和后端API。 Nodejs因其非阻滯I/O模型而聞名輕巧有效,并且

如何在RHEL,Rocky和Almalinux中設(shè)置MySQL復(fù)制 如何在RHEL,Rocky和Almalinux中設(shè)置MySQL復(fù)制 Jul 05, 2025 am 09:27 AM

數(shù)據(jù)復(fù)制是將數(shù)據(jù)復(fù)制到多個服務(wù)器中以提高數(shù)據(jù)可用性并增強(qiáng)應(yīng)用程序的可靠性和性能的過程。在mySQL復(fù)制中,數(shù)據(jù)從主服務(wù)器的數(shù)據(jù)庫復(fù)制到OT

See all articles